The Butcher Sisters - 31.01.2026 Hannover - Ticket
Shops selling The Butcher Sisters - 31.01.2026 Hannover - Ticket
Show price history The Butcher Sisters - 31.01.2026 Hannover - Ticket
History of lowetst price The Butcher Sisters - 31.01.2026 Hannover - Ticket. Compare price of The Butcher Sisters - 31.01.2026 Hannover - Ticket.